The Real Issue: Shuffling Is a Logistics Decision, Not a Pedagogy Decision
The problem starts when shuffling is treated as a default feature rather than a deliberate assessment strategy. When you shuffle questions and answer options, you are not just changing the order of text. You are altering the cognitive load, the sequencing of concepts, and potentially the difficulty of the exam.
Consider a question set where Question 5 introduces a formula that Question 12 then applies. Shuffling those questions breaks the logical dependency. Students who see Question 12 first may not have the context to answer it, not because they lack knowledge but because the assessment structure failed them. That is a validity problem, not a student problem.
Similarly, shuffling answer options can accidentally make a question easier or harder. If an answer option includes “all of the above” or “none of the above,” its position relative to other options changes how students parse the logic. A shuffler that blindly reorders options can turn a well-designed question into a guessing game.
Why This Matters Operationally
When you deploy a shuffled exam, you are committing to several operational promises: every version is equivalent in difficulty, every answer key maps correctly to its version, and every student receives the right version. For a 20-question classroom quiz, that is manageable. For a 100-question, high-stakes, multi-section exam across 300 students, the margin for error shrinks dramatically.
The operational cost is not the shuffling itself — it is the verification. Someone must check that each generated version is pedagogically sound, that answer keys are accurate, and that version distribution does not introduce bias. If your team does not have the capacity to review every version, then a shuffler is not saving you time; it is creating a new audit burden.
What Good Looks Like: When Shuffling Actually Works
A university quiz shuffler is appropriate when all of the following are true:
- Questions are independent (no question references another question’s content or answer).
- Answer options are homogeneous (all options are single concepts, no compound logic, no “all of the above”).
- The assessment is low-stakes or formative (quizzes, practice tests, in-class checks).
- You have time to spot-check each generated version.
- The tool runs locally, so no student data leaves your institution.

Common Mistakes When Using a Shuffler
The most frequent mistake is using a shuffler for summative, high-stakes exams without a review protocol. Lecturers often assume that if the tool generated the version, it must be valid. That assumption fails when questions have internal dependencies or when answer options contain qualifying phrases like “always” or “never.”
Another mistake is shuffling questions but not answer options (or vice versa) inconsistently across versions. This creates detectable patterns. Students in a later sitting can infer that Version B is a permutation of Version A, which undermines the integrity you were trying to protect.
Finally, many teams neglect the answer key verification step. A shuffler can generate keys, but if the original question set had a typo in the answer field, that error propagates to every version. The tool is only as reliable as the input.
How to Evaluate Your Assessment Before You Shuffle
Before you click “Generate Versions,” run a quick audit:
- Map dependencies. Read your question set top to bottom. If any question references a previous question, a figure, or a formula introduced earlier, do not shuffle the question order.
- Check option logic. Look for options that are not single, discrete statements. If you see “both A and B,” “all of the above,” or “none of the above,” do not shuffle answer options.
- Confirm the stakes. If the exam counts for more than 20% of a final grade, treat shuffling as a high-risk operation that requires manual review of every version.
- Test the output. Generate one version, print it, and take the exam yourself. If you cannot complete it without referencing the original order, neither can your students.
If your assessment fails any of these checks, do not use a shuffler. Instead, consider alternative integrity measures: multiple question pools with manual selection, randomized question selection (not order) from a validated bank, or proctored single-version exams.

Frequently Asked Questions
Can I use a quiz shuffler for final exams? Only if your questions are fully independent, options are simple, and you manually review every generated version. For most final exams, this is not practical.
Does shuffling prevent cheating? It reduces answer-sharing between adjacent students, but it does not prevent collusion, and it can introduce fairness issues if versions are not equivalent.
What is the biggest risk with a shuffler? Unnoticed question dependencies. A student may receive a version where a prerequisite concept appears after the question that depends on it.
Should I shuffle answer options always? No. If any option contains compound logic, or if the question uses “all of the above,” shuffling changes the question’s meaning.
